Dr. Xiang receives Presidential Professorship

May 1, 2020 by shawn xiang

Liangzhong “Shawn” Xiang has received Lloyd G. and Joyce Austin Presidential Professorship.

Xiang emphasizes teaching students cutting-edge research and advanced technologies through active research programs that effectively complement classroom studies and enhance the undergraduate and graduate curricula.

He received the Nancy L. Mergler Faculty Mentor Award for Undergraduate Research at OU in 2017. In addition to the support of undergraduate students through his individual mentoring, he also mentors undergraduate student researchers in his lab through the University of Oklahoma Undergraduate Research Opportunities Program, First Year Research Experience, and the Honors Research Assistant Program.

The Presidential Professorships were established to recognize those faculty members who excel in all their professional activities and who relate those activities to the student they teach and mentor. The number of Professorships awarded annually is based on current availability of funds.
